Brevard races are on: Qualifying closes

Florida Rep. Ritch Workman and two Canaveral Port Authority commissioners — Jerry Allender and Tom Weinberg — won re-election at noon Friday, when no one qualified to run against them.

 In addition, two incumbent Brevard School Board members — Michael Krupp in District 1 and Barbara Murray in District 2 — will not be serving after this year, as they did not file paperwork to run for re-election.But there will be lots of other candidates on the ballot for the Aug. 26 primary and the Nov. 4 general election.

Three incumbent Republican state legislators from Brevard County will face Republican challengers in primaries — Sen. Thad Altman, Rep. Tom Goodson and Rep. John Tobia. In Altman and Goodson’s cases, there are no Democratic challengers, so the primary will, in effect, decide the election, although the primary winner in Altman’s district will have a write-in opponent in November.
